Accelerators and incubators are essential for helping new startups take flight.

New entrepreneurs looking to transform their great business idea into a successful and sustainable business sometimes don’t have the experience or connections to make that happen on their own.

The staff of an accelerator or incubator can help by providing support, space, mentorship, connections and more.

To help you out, we've compiled a list of 28 accelerators and incubators that invest in the Transportation industry.

1) Brinc

Brinc is a venture financing and accelerator organization that helps game changers solve some of the world's most difficult problems.

Details of the startup:

  • Country: Hong Kong
  • City: Central
  • Started in: 2014
  • Founders: Bashar Aboudaoud, Bay McLaughlin, Manav Gupta
  • Number of investments: 127
  • Number of exits: 1
  • Accelerator Duration (in weeks): 10

2) Elemental Excelerator

Elemental Excelerator is a startup accelerator that helps startups transform the world one community at a time.

Details of the startup:

  • Country: United States
  • City: Honolulu
  • Started in: 2012
  • Founders: Dawn Lippert, Jill Sims
  • Number of investments: 68
  • Number of exits: 11

3) Clean Energy Trust

Early-stage startups working on clean energy, decarbonization, and environmental sustainability are supported by the Clean Energy Trust.

Details of the startup:

  • Country: United States
  • City: Chicago
  • Started in: 2010
  • Founders: Amy Francetic, Michael Polsky, Nick Pritzker
  • Number of investments: 37
  • Number of exits: 3
